Output 8fa34df602ed34b2c6aff804e28a232985fee669ece96eb2c1f0c21f6f602849:37

value
1487028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62a7b5f47d84d20b46be4cd58581e343f6178039 OP_EQUAL
address
3Agf46EuNzX2ya72QoYoZJ3AM6BWug6TgX
transaction
8fa34df602ed34b2c6aff804e28a232985fee669ece96eb2c1f0c21f6f602849
spent
true